查找数据
更新时间: 2022-07-25 浏览次数: {{ hits }}

自动化查找满足条件的表单数据,用于后置执行动作,例如发送短信、新增数据、更新数据等。

  • 目标表单:查找主表、子表数据

  • 满足条件:条件编辑器支持目标表单字段,查找子表数据时,支持子表字段。

注:自动化条件编辑器暂不支持太多函数,反馈需求,自动化将持续优化。

image.png


执行方式

使用前置节点数据,依次查找目标表单匹配关联规则的数据,合并数据

  • 支持的节点类型:数据发生变化时、产生新数据时、查找数据

  • 关联规则:左侧选择节点数据字段,右侧选择目标表单字段,按照关联规则合并数据。

  • 满足条件:满足条件的合并数据,条件编辑器支持目标表单字段、节点数据字段。

  • 详情见下方示例

适用场景订单触发,查找产品库存,库存不足时,消息提醒;制定生产计划,查找生成产品物料明细BOM。详情见自动化示例。

image.png


使用限制

自动化:一个自动化至多配置3个查找数据

执行方式:至多使用100条节点数据,依次查找数据

查找数据:至多查找100条数据


查找主表数据

场景

定时查找将近过期或已过期的合同,提醒客户经理跟进


输入(执行方式)


查找

合同(主表数据)

image.png


输出

满足条件:DAYS(合同.合同到期时间, NOW()) <=7 (假设当前时间为2021-01-15 00:00)

image.png


查找子表数据

场景

定时查找将近过期或已过期的租赁设备,提醒客户经理跟进


输入(执行方式)


查找

客户.租赁设备(子表数据)

image.png


输出

满足条件:DAYS(客户.租赁设备.到期时间, NOW())<=7(假设当前时间为2021-01-14 00:00)

image.png


使用触发主表数据,查找主表数据

场景

订单支付成功后,查找和校验订单产品库存


输入(执行方式)

使用 数据发生变化时/订单 主表数据,依次执行

image.png


查找

产品(子表数据)

image.png


输出

满足条件:订单.产品 == 产品.产品

image.png


使用触发主表数据,查找子表数据

场景

计划生产时,查找产品所需物料明细


输入(执行方式)

使用 产生新数据时/生产计划 主表数据,依次执行

image.png


查找

产品.物料明细(子表数据)

image.png


输出

关联规则:生产计划.生产产品 == 产品.产品

image.png


使用触发子表数据,查找主表数据

场景

订单支付成功后,查找和校验订单商品库存,库存不足的商品提醒相关人员。


输入(执行方式)

使用 数据发生变化时/商品明细 数据,依次执行

image.png


查找

库存管理(主表数据)

image.png


输出

关联规则:商品明细.商品 == 库存管理

满足条件:商品明细.数量 < 库存管理.库存

image.png


使用触发子表数据,查找子表数据

场景

计划生产时,查找产品所需物料明细


输入(执行方式)

使用 产生新数据时/生产计划.生产明细 数据,依次执行

image.png


查找

产品.物料明细(子表数据)

image.png


输出

关联规则:生产明细.产品 == 物料明细.下一级产品

image.png


使用查找数据,查找数据

场景

计划生产时,查找产品所需物料明细(多层级)


输入(执行方式)

使用 查找数据,依次执行

image.png


查找

产品.物料明细(子表数据)

image.png


输出

满足条件:产品.产品 == 查找数据.物料明细.材料

image.png


需求反馈

没有适用的功能?无法实现场景?欢迎反馈需求